Output 0d626269d1e2503c16c7cab57bb9a7f7f16d4be965508f255d694733d6ecbafc:1

value
723610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2497eb05e5f25b4fbcc6a6c3f80f31cd964145c6 OP_EQUAL
address
352WEuEdawDCbn1enaC3bmJRY2bwSSSjXS
transaction
0d626269d1e2503c16c7cab57bb9a7f7f16d4be965508f255d694733d6ecbafc
confirmations
424889
spent
true